The battle of the barents sea was a world war ii naval engagement on 31 december 1942 between warships of the german navy kriegsmarine and british ships escorting convoy jw 51b to kola inlet in the ussr. The barents sea is more than four times the size of norway and is a productive area because it is comparatively shallow, only 230 metres on average, and because it is here that the cold water from the arctic ocean meets the warm atlantic water that is being carried northwards by the gulf stream. The main feature of the winter air temperature distribution is the socalled warmth pole in the icefree southwestern barents sea, where the average january sea temperature is close to 0c.
